Let's examine accrual accounting. Why not just use the simple cash basis? What are some of the benefits of using accrual accounting?

What type of important information is ignored by cash basis accounting?

Why do companies prepare adjusting journal entries?

Would you apply cash basis accounting or accrual basis accounting if you were a business owner? Please explain.

An accounting firm received $5,000 cash for consulting services to be rendered in the future. The full amount was credited to Unearned Service Revenue. If the consulting services were rendered by the end of the accounting period and no adjusting journal entry was made, what would be the impact on the financial statements?

A company received a check for $18,000 on July 1st, which represents a 3-month advance payment of rent on a building it rents to a client. Unearned Rent Revenue was credited for the full $18,000. Financial statements will be prepared on July 31st. What is the adjusting journal entry that should be made at July 31st?

Randy Company purchased $2,000 of supplies during the month. At the end of the month, $300 of supplies remained. There were no supplies at the beginning of the month. Prepare the adjusting journal entry at the end of the month.
